Abstract

The utility model provides a novel digital display lever dial gauge, which belongs to a measuring apparatus. The novel digital display lever dial gauge primarily comprises a digital display assembly, a main body part, a lever assembly, a rotary base plate and so on. The digital display assembly is fastened with the rotary base plate. A reflecting grating assembly is connected with the upper inner side of the main body part with a fillister head screw. An emission grating and a circuit board are fixed on the top surface of the reflecting grating assembly with bolts. A reflecting grating is bonded to a turntable on the reflecting grating assembly with AB adhesive. An O-shaped ring is arranged in the external slot of the rotary base plate. The rotary base plate is connected with the upper left side of the main body part with a cross-notch sunk screw. A long adjustable bolt is connected with the lower right side of the main body part through thread, and a short adjustable bolt is connected with the lower left side of the main body part through thread. The novel digital display lever dial gauge has the advantages of compact structure, stable and reliable quality, high precision and so on, which can be widely applied for the detection and calibration of the shape and position tolerance of mechanical components and parts.

Background technology
The lever indicating gauge is to use survey instrument more widely.Mechanical lever indicating gauge does not have the directly perceived of digital display lever indicating gauge because of reading, and data can not output to computing machine and printer, is just progressively replaced by the digital display lever indicating gauge.
The manufacturing of domestic existing digital display lever indicating gauge is started late, and technology is still not mature enough, the quality instability, and precision is relatively poor, makes the popularization of digital display lever indicating gauge be subjected to certain influence.

Embodiment
From Fig. 1, Fig. 2, can find out, digital display assembly 1 is fastened and connected with rotating basis 11, one end of flat cable 2 is connected with the connector of digital display assembly 1, the other end with the emission grid 8 circuit board on connector be connected, body cover 3 is connected with slotted countersunk flat head screw 4 with the right side of main element 13, and an end of reflecting grating spring 5 is connected with spring pin on the rotating disk of reflecting grating 9, and the other end is connected with spring pin on the reflecting grating assembly 7, after rotating reflecting grating 8, make digital reset return zero.Reflecting grating assembly 7 usefulness slotted cheese head screws 6 are connected with going up of main element 13 is inboard, emission grid 8 are screwed in the end face of reflecting grating assembly 7 together with circuit board, rotating disk on reflecting grating 9 usefulness AB glue and the reflecting grating assembly 7 is bonding, O type circle 10 places the water jacket of rotating basis 11, rotating basis 11 usefulness cross recessed countersunk head sscrews 12 are connected with the upper left side of main element 13, and digital display assembly display screen can rotate counterclockwise 352 ° with the rotating basis center.Long roll adjustment screw 14 is threaded with the following right side of main element 13, and minor is threaded with the following left side of main element 13 apart from screw 15.
From Fig. 3, can find out among Fig. 4, fillister head screw 16 is threaded with the middle left side of main body 17, main body 17 is the deckle board of an installation mechanical parts, the installation component 19 that resets is screwed on the deckle board of main body 17, the two ends of reset assembly 18 axis are connected with mesopore on the deckle board of reset installation component 19 and main body 17 respectively with the ruby bearing, two pieces of supporting screws 20 are threaded with the lower end of main body 17 respectively, in order to support lever assembly 22, and be locked with back nut 21 respectively, measuring staff gauge head 23 is connected with the screw lower thread of lever assembly 22, roll adjustment screw 25 is threaded with the screw top of lever assembly 22, can be by roll adjustment screw 25 fine setting R, reach best lever ratio, make precision satisfy 2 π R=5.08k3 (k is an enlargement factor).Solved in the past because the lever ratio difficulty is adjusted and the equipped problem of measuring staff of the different length of palpus processing with regard to effective like this.
Fig. 5 is the structural diagrams of reflecting grating, and its feature is: the grizzly bar figure has 9 groups (1 every group).
Fig. 6 is the structural diagrams of emission grid, and its feature is: the grizzly bar figure has 3 groups (8 every group).
